Welcome to Henley-on-Thames station, a charming little hub nestled in the scenic town that shares its name. Henley-on-Thames is renowned for its picturesque views and vibrant cultural scene, making it a popular destination for both locals and tourists. Whether you're headed to London or exploring the local attractions, Henley-on-Thames station is a convenient starting point for your journey.
The station is equipped with essential amenities, ensuring a smooth travel experience. While there's no ticket office service on Sundays, travelers can use the convenient ticket machines available daily. For online ticket purchases, collection is a breeze using these machines. Accessibility is a key feature at the station, with step-free access throughout and designated areas for those with mobility impairments.
Although there are no toilets or shopping facilities on-site, the station ensures safety and comfort with seating areas, CCTV cameras, and customer help points available. For cyclists, there are ample bicycle storage facilities, including the option to hire a Brompton bike, perfect for exploring the town and its surroundings.
Henley-on-Thames station offers numerous onward travel options. Whether you're catching a bus, hailing a taxi, or considering hiring a bicycle, you'll find convenient services to suit your needs. For air travelers, links are available via nearby Reading station, connecting to Heathrow and Gatwick airports. Langley Green train station might not be as famously known as some of the larger UK rail hubs, but it certainly offers a range of facilities and interesting travel opportunities. Whether you’re a frequent commuter or an occasional traveler, getting to know this station can enhance your journey and travel experience.
Langley Green station provides several amenities for its passengers. The station operates a ticket office with limited opening hours on weekdays and Saturdays, which is a great opportunity for commuters to grab their tickets. Conveniently, there are 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ting tickets at all times, although it's worth noting that these aren't accessible. Sadly, the station lacks smartcard infrastructure for those who rely on more modern conveniences.
For customer assistance, there are help points and customer information screens that include departure screens and announcements. Staff are available at varying times through the week to offer assistance. The station prides itself on being accredited by the Secure Station Scheme, ensuring passenger safety.
Though the station is accessible in parts, there's only partial step-free access, thus it might pose challenges for those with mobility issues. Key accessibility features include ramps for train access but unfortunately, no accessible toilets are provided. The car park offers free parking with CCTV coverage and includes two accessible spaces. Unfortunately, there are no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ATM machines available, so plan to grab your coffee or snacks beforehand.
Langley Green is well-connected with alternative transport modes, making it easy to continue your journey post-train travel. For any rail replacement services, passengers can find vehicles operating from Western Road, just outside the station’s car park. As for taxis, there are reliable local services like Oldbury, Chapel, and Apollo, all reachable via phone for a quick pickup.
If you're planning an onward journey via bus, more information is available online, and, it's easy to find printable options for planning. This makes the station an excellent starting point for both short trips and lengthier excursions.
